Symptoms

  • •Coolant puddles under the vehicle
  • •Overheating engine
  • •Low coolant warning light illuminated
  • •Sweet smell of coolant inside or outside the vehicle
  • •Steam from the engine bay
  • •Reduced heater performance

Solution
1. Preparation
  • Gather tools and parts required.
  • Ensure the engine is cool before starting to prevent burns.
  • Disconnect the battery to avoid any electrical issues.
2. Drain Coolant
  • Place a drain pan under the radiator.
  • Open the radiator drain valve or remove the lower radiator hose to drain coolant.
  • Dispose of the old coolant properly according to local regulations.
3. Inspect and Replace Components
  • Hoses and Clamps:
    • Remove any damaged hoses and replace with new ones.
    • Tighten or replace clamps as needed.
  • Radiator:
    • If leaks are found, remove the radiator by disconnecting the upper and lower hoses and the transmission cooler lines (if applicable).
    • Replace with a new radiator if damaged.
  • Water Pump:
    • If the water pump is leaking, remove it by unscrewing the mounting bolts.
    • Clean the mounting surface on the engine block and install a new water pump with a new gasket, tightening to manufacturer specifications (typically 10-15 ft-lbs).
  • Coolant Reservoir:
    • If the reservoir is cracked, remove it and replace with a new unit.
4. Refill Cooling System
  • Reconnect all hoses and components.
  • Fill the cooling system with the recommended coolant mixture (usually a 50/50 mix of antifreeze and distilled water).
  • Bleed the cooling system to remove air pockets using the bleed valve if equipped.
5. Final Checks
  • Reconnect the battery.
  • Start the engine and allow it to reach operating temperature while monitoring for leaks.
  • Check coolant level after the engine has cooled, and top off as necessary.
